config: move operational defaults to docker-compose.yml

- Add conversion service configuration with sensible defaults
  - BOOKHOARD_CONVERSION_CACHE_DIR: /app/cache/kepub
  - BOOKHOARD_CONVERSION_TOOL: /usr/bin/kepubify
  - BOOKHOARD_CONVERSION_CACHE_TTL: 24h
  - Add named volume for conversion cache
- Add rate limiting configuration with defaults
  - TEST_MODE: false
  - RATE_LIMIT_ENABLED: true
  - REQUESTS_PER_MINUTE: 10
- Simplify .env.example to only required secrets (JWT_SECRET, DBPASS)
- Add section comments to docker-compose.yml for better organization
- Document optional overrides in .env.example comments

This change separates secrets (in .env) from operational configuration
(in docker-compose.yml), following security best practices while
maintaining flexibility for custom deployments.
